Salary overview

The median wage for Computer Occupations, All Other in Jackson, MI is $128,570 per year, 10.3% above the national median of $116,580. Pay ranges from under $57,100 at the tenth percentile to more than $169,620 at the ninetieth, with the interquartile range running from $59,740 to $162,200.

Employment stands at 110, or 2.0 jobs per thousand held locally. Battle Creek leads the state's metro areas for this occupation, at $112,400. Set against every other occupation measured in the same area, it ranks 17th of 231 by median pay.

What the pay is worth locally

Prices in Jackson run 3.8% below the national average, so the median of $128,570 goes as far as $133,649 would elsewhere in the country. Measured that way it compares to the national median at 14.6% above the national median in real terms.
